Why Replace Cast Iron Pipes

First things first - why replace cast iron pipes at all? These pipes were popular for years due to their strength and longevity in plumbing systems. Still, like anything with age comes potential weakness: cast iron can rust and corrode over time, leading to leaks, water damage, and quality reduction of your drinking water. Therefore, replacing these old pipes ensures your plumbing works effectively and keeps the water safe for consumption while simultaneously making home plumbing systems run more smoothly overall.

Deciding When to Replace

Calling in a plumber for pipe replacement requires being like a detective: you must keep an eye out for clues indicating you need one - such as water discoloration, slow drains, or mysterious leaks appearing around your home; these could all indicate there may be an urgent need for plumbing repair service - don't wait for major issues before acting; catch those little indicators early before they turn into major plumbing disasters!
